1818 x 21660
1818 x 21660 = 39377880
Example of 1818 x 21660 pixels banner dimensions.
1768 x 21710 1778 x 21700 1788 x 21690 1798 x 21680 1808 x 21670
1818 x 21610 1818 x 21620 1818 x 21630 1818 x 21640 1818 x 21650
1818 x 21710 1818 x 21700 1818 x 21690 1818 x 21680 1818 x 21670